Top Industry Leaders in the Silicone Coatings Market
This versatile material offers exceptional properties like heat resistance, water repellency, electrical insulation, and anti-adhesion, making it a sought-after solution across diverse industries. Strategies for Success:
-
Product Diversification: Leading companies are expanding their portfolios beyond traditional solvent-based coatings, venturing into water-based and solventless options to cater to environmental regulations and specific application needs. -
Technological Advancements: Continuous R&D efforts focus on developing high-performance coatings with enhanced durability, scratch resistance, and self-cleaning capabilities. Innovations in UV-curable and low-VOC formulations are gaining traction. -
Regional Focus: Asia-Pacific is the fastest-growing market segment, driven by booming construction and automotive sectors. Companies are strategically establishing production facilities and partnerships in this region. -
Sustainability Initiatives: Increasing environmental awareness is prompting manufacturers to adopt eco-friendly practices, utilizing bio-based materials and minimizing waste. This resonates with environmentally conscious consumers and businesses. -
Strategic Partnerships: Collaborations with research institutions, end-use industries, and distributors facilitate knowledge sharing, market access, and product development.
Factors Influencing Market Share:
-
Brand Recognition: Established brands like Dow, Momentive, and Wacker Chemie hold a significant market share due to their long-standing reputation for quality and reliability. -
Cost Competitiveness: Price remains a crucial factor, especially in emerging markets. Manufacturers are optimizing production processes and sourcing strategies to maintain competitive pricing. -
Innovation: Companies investing heavily in R&D and novel technologies gain an edge by offering superior products and catering to niche applications. -
Regulatory Compliance: Stringent environmental regulations, particularly in Europe, are driving the demand for eco-friendly silicone coatings. Manufacturers compliant with these regulations gain market advantage. -
Distribution Channels: Robust distribution networks ensure efficient product delivery and market penetration. Partnerships with distributors and retailers play a crucial role.
